Transaction e8c73509a03c7bc612942ea7cc9662f91b1cae4814d108c43bc41492fa54e485
1 Input
1 Output
-
e8c73509a03c7bc612942ea7cc9662f91b1cae4814d108c43bc41492fa54e485:0
- value
- 493700
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bd58c8d0b699f8eaf174a39e312fd083d9a8752a5ebf2d69289011eb225eb1bf
- address
- bc1ph4vv359kn8uw4ut55w0rzt7ss0v6saf2t6lj66fgjqg7kgj7kxlsd4vfea